From 2fe11cd77ac45e3291405ab09dc6e289d2a493b5 Mon Sep 17 00:00:00 2001 From: gcarq Date: Sat, 25 Nov 2017 03:28:18 +0100 Subject: [PATCH] add helper scripts for mongodb --- scripts/start-hyperopt-worker.sh | 11 +++++++++-- scripts/start-mongodb.sh | 6 +++--- 2 files changed, 12 insertions(+), 5 deletions(-) diff --git a/scripts/start-hyperopt-worker.sh b/scripts/start-hyperopt-worker.sh index ffe4753cb..1b0d240ca 100755 --- a/scripts/start-hyperopt-worker.sh +++ b/scripts/start-hyperopt-worker.sh @@ -1,5 +1,12 @@ -#!/bin/bash +#!/bin/bash -e DB_NAME=freqtrade_hyperopt -hyperopt-mongo-worker --mongo=127.0.0.1:1234/${DB_NAME} --poll-interval=0.1 +DIR="$( cd "$( dirname "${BASH_SOURCE[0]}" )" && pwd )" +WORK_DIR="${DIR}/../.hyperopt/worker" + +mkdir -p "${WORK_DIR}" +hyperopt-mongo-worker \ + --mongo="127.0.0.1:1234/${DB_NAME}" \ + --poll-interval=0.1 \ + --workdir="${WORK_DIR}" \ No newline at end of file diff --git a/scripts/start-mongodb.sh b/scripts/start-mongodb.sh index 5a1758d04..02b6624f4 100755 --- a/scripts/start-mongodb.sh +++ b/scripts/start-mongodb.sh @@ -1,10 +1,10 @@ #!/bin/bash -e DIR="$( cd "$( dirname "${BASH_SOURCE[0]}" )" && pwd )" -DB_PATH="${DIR}/../.mongodb" +DB_PATH="${DIR}/../.hyperopt/mongodb" -mkdir -p ${DB_PATH} -mongod --dbpath ${DB_PATH} \ +mkdir -p "${DB_PATH}" +mongod --dbpath "${DB_PATH}" \ --bind_ip 127.0.0.1 \ --port 1234 \ --directoryperdb \